A leading sustainable infrastructure company in the UK is seeking a skilled Resourcing Business Partner for the maintenance of plant and equipment. The role requires a proactive approach to repair and maintenance, adhering to health and safety standards.

The ideal candidate will have experience in industrial maintenance, possess electrical or mechanical skills, and be able to multitask effectively.

The position includes generous benefits such as holiday, pension contributions, and health initiatives.
